Leveling Up Your Game Dev Skills

Want create captivating games that enthrall players? The journey of becoming a skilled game developer is an exciting one, filled with challenges and rewards. To truly master your craft, dive into these essential areas:

  • Basic Programming Concepts: A solid grasp of programming languages like C++, Java, or C# is the bedrock of game development.
  • Game Engines: Familiarize yourself with popular engines like Unity or Unreal Engine to streamline your creation process.
  • Captivating Art and Design: Learn the principles of visual design, animation, and sound design to enrich your game's experience.
  • Level Crafting: Master the art of creating engaging and balanced levels that captivate.
  • Networking Development: Explore the intricacies of connecting players in a virtual world for a truly collaborative experience.

Remember, the key to advancing as a game developer is continuous learning and practice.

Crafting Immersive Worlds: A Guide to Environment Design

A compelling environment is the foundation of any immersive experience. Players should sense a world that is alive and dynamic. This means carefully crafting every detail, from the structure of landscapes to the nuanced interactions between objects. click here

Consider how players will move through your world. Will they be venturing a vast wilderness, or delving into the depths of a mysterious dungeon?

The types of environments you create should reflect the mood you want to convey.

A lush, verdant forest can evoke a sense of peace, while a dark, ominous cave might breed feelings of fear.

By paying heed to these factors, you can construct environments that are not only aesthetically stunning but also deeply engaging.

Bridging the Gap Between Code and Creation

Game development is a dynamic blend of technical prowess and artistic vision. It's the process of transforming abstract concepts into immersive worlds. Developers craft digital realities, weaving code into captivating narratives and engaging gameplay experiences. Each line of code acts as a brushstroke, painting pixels onto the canvas of the virtual world. From character design to environmental storytelling, game development is a collaborative art form that redefines the lines between technology and imagination.

  • Programmers wield their tools to create the intricate mechanics that bring games to life.
  • Artists breathe life into characters, environments, and objects, imbuing them with personality and style.
  • Composers craft sonic landscapes that transport players into the heart of the game world.

Balancing Gameplay: Mechanics that Captivate Players

Successfully crafting a game experience that keeps players coming back for more hinges on finding the sweet spot of balancing gameplay mechanics. It's about crafting systems that are simultaneously intriguing without becoming overly frustrating. A well-balanced game provides a sense of achievement as players master its intricacies.

One key aspect is providing players with a sense of power over their actions. This can be achieved through choices that have tangible outcomes, allowing players to alter the game world around them.

Furthermore, incorporating elements of surprise keeps the gameplay fresh. This could involve introducing unpredictable events, hidden secrets, or evolving challenges that test players' strategic thinking.

  • Finally, striking the right balance is a delicate process that involves carefully considering player motivations and expectations. By emphasizing immersion, developers can create games that are both captivating and rewarding.

Game Development Economics: Income Generation and Audience Reach

In today's competitive gaming industry, understanding successful monetization and marketing strategies is paramount for developers seeking to capture a large audience. Monetization models have evolved beyond the traditional physical model, embracing online distribution platforms, subscriptions, and advertising. Marketing efforts regularly leverage a diverse approach, incorporating social media to build brand perception and drive customer acquisition.

  • Engaging gameplay remains the foundation of any successful game, but strategic monetization and marketing influence a crucial role in attracting players and cultivating a loyal community.
  • Analyzing player behavior through market research allows developers to refine their monetization and marketing plans.

Consequently, the combination of compelling gameplay, strategic monetization, and effective marketing determines the prosperity of a game in the dynamic gaming landscape.

Solo Game Development: A Roadmap to Success

Diving into the thriving world of indie game development can be both enticing. It's a path filled with passion, but it also demands dedication. To excel in this competitive landscape, you need a solid roadmap. Initially, identify your niche. What kind of game are you passionate to create? Is it an action-packed experience or something more character-centric?

  • Establish your target audience. Who are you making this game for? Understanding their desires will help you craft a game they'll truly love.
  • Develop a clear strategy. This should include the fundamental gameplay of your game, as well as your artistic style.
  • Collaborate with other indie developers. The community is supportive, and you can learn from their wisdom.

Remember that game development is an continuous evolution. Be willing to criticism, and refine your game based on what you learn. With hard work, a solid roadmap, and a willingness to adapt, you can achieve success in the indie game development world.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“Leveling Up Your Game Dev Skills ”

Leave a Reply

Gravatar